Foundation Passport is a Bitcoin-only, air-gapped hardware wallet with open-source firmware and a phone-like interface, using QR codes as the default way to sign. It tries to make air-gapped storage feel modern rather than fiddly.
It suits people who want the security of air-gapped signing with a UX that doesn’t fight them, and who prefer Bitcoin-only devices. It sits at the premium end; the payoff is a polished, verify-friendly experience for serious self-custody.
